WebThe degree of DNA alkylation correlates well with the cytotoxicity of these drugs. The interaction with DNA also accounts for the mutagenic and carcinogenic potential of these drugs. The 7‐nitrogen (N7) and 6‐oxygen (O6) of guanine have been shown to be particularly susceptible to attack by electrophilic compounds.
